A theoretical framework on the social dimension of the smartness of the Smart Cities

Donizete Ferreira Beck, Wilson Levy Braga Da Silva Neto, Antônio Joelson Rodrigues Bezerra, Victória de Melo Araújo, Carla Gomes Rodrigues Távora

Abstract


Globalization and the ubiquitous use of Information and Communication Technologies are, nowadays, the main characteristics of the international context of cities. Under this context, the Smart Cities have emerged to address various urban issues and improve the quality of life of the population through technologies, effective public policies and urban systems. We identified and explored the social dimension of smart cities, which is incipient. The method used is a literature review under qualitative and exploratory analysis. We created a theoretical framework on the social dimension of the Smart Cities. Urban governance is the nucleus of the social dimension, which is composed of the social value produced by civic engagement and Informational and Communicational Technologies. Hence, there is the urban environment transformation of the smart cities that benefits whole the society. Also, we identified the social agents of this process: the public power, the industry, the enterprises, the society and the academy. We identified the main social aspects, whose are strong social bonds, public security improved, and better urban accessibility. The interaction among the social dimension nucleus (governance, Informational and Communicational Technologies and social values), the social aspects and the social agents emphasize public service efficiency; sustainable urban development; public systems innovation; structural modernization; and human and educational development. There are future studies implications suggested, which one is that this proposed framework can be used for case studies on the social dimension of the smart cities.
